Report
RECOMMENDATION:
It is recommended that the Board of Supervisors:
a. Approve to amend the Sheriff’s Office FY 2025-26 Adopted Budget, 001-2300-8273-SHE001, to reallocate one (1.0) Full-Time Equivalent (FTE) Senior Account Clerk to one (1.0) FTE Accounting Technician, as indicated in Attachment A (4/5th vote required);
b. Authorize the Auditor-Controller to incorporate the approved changes in the Sheriff’s Office FY 2025-26 Adopted Budget; and
c. Direct the Human Resources Department to implement the changes in the Advantage Human Resources Management (HRM) system.
SUMMARY
The Sheriff’s Office is seeking approval and authorizationfrom the Board of Supervisors to reallocate one vacant (1.0) FTE Senior Account Clerk to one (1.0) FTE Accounting Technician.
DISCUSSION:
The Sheriff’s Office is requesting to reallocate one vacant (1.0) FTE Senior Account Clerk to one (1.0) FTE Accounting Technician. The Senior Account Clerk position became vacant due to a competitive employee promotion to Accounting Technician.
Historically, the Sheriff’s Office has had one (1.0 FTE) Accounting Technician within the Fiscal Division’s Accounts Payable/Receivable Unit.
